why is my truck idleing so high ? on 1998 Mazda B3000

i already did fuel filter , spark plugs and wires ,air intake and air filter , transducer "cam sync" , cam positioning sensor . yet i still have an idle issue but no longer an engine light so ???????????????????????? why would my truck idleing so high ?

Asked by for the 1998 Mazda B3000
All the things that you have checked or replaced do not create a high idle. Look for vacuum leaks and idle control motor problems.